Ray Mason started his first band in 1966 and has been going strong ever since! Between 1983-1990, Ray (along with his trusty 1965 Silvertone guitar) released five critically acclaimed (cassette only) albums. He followed them with a single on his own Captivating Music label and has appeared on numerous compilations from such labels as East Side Digital, Shimmy Disc, Sound Asleep ( Sweden), Signature Sounds, Dren Records and Paisley Pop.
Ray's tunes follow no trend while keeping an upward slide on the songwriting scale. It's rock with the roll!! A man and his Silvertone!!

After graduating college, Adrienne worked with many musicians, joined several bands, but eventually felt the need to be on her own to flourish. In 2005 she decided to take a more serious focus on her music and recorded her first solo CD “Wake Up” consisting of covers as well as originals.
In 2007 she recorded her second CD, "Fearless" containing all original music. Adrienne’s life stories radiate through her songs, laden with strong emotion. Adrienne’s powerful voice can grip your attention, take hold and you won’t be free until she’s done. She has a unique style and sound-a truly gifted singer and songwriter.

In the mid-80’s, Kuhn co-founded the popular ‘All Star Trio’, with bassist Ron Carter and drummer Al Foster, and launched a new, and still evolving, edition of his trio with bassist David Finck. Drummers for the latter have included Joey Baron (as on the ECM recording Remembering Tomorrow), Lewis Nash, Billy Drummond, Kenny Washington, and Bill Stewart. In the 90’s up to the present time, he has recorded CDs for Venus, Reservoir, and Sunnyside.
In 2004, Kuhn recorded Promises Kept, which includes a string orchestra for ECM Records, of which he is most proud. Kuhn continues to tour widely throughout the world, with a strong following in Europe and especially Japan where his CDs frequently appear on the jazz chart

Allan Holdsworth is widely regarded by fans and contemporary musicians as one of the 20 th century's most prominent guitarists. He is one of a handful of musicians who has consistently proven himself as an innovator in between and within the worlds of rock and jazz music. Many of music's best-known instrumental masters cite Holdsworth as that rare and shining voice-a legendary player who continues to push the outer limits of instrumental technique and the electric guitar's range of tonal and textural possibilities. Particularly during the 90s, Holdsworth has enjoyed the recognition so many musicians strongly feel he deserves, given that he has developed his career outside the big label mainstream and has consistently produced his own recordings with complete creative control since the mid-80s.
Despite the uncompromising nature of Holdsworth's predominantly genre-defying solo projects, he's no stranger to all-star jazz festival line-ups or large venue rock audiences. Musician Magazine placed Holdsworth near the top of their "100 greatest guitarists of all time." There's never been a shortage of media attention or acclaim for Holdsworth's accomplishments and originality. An inductee of Guitar Player Magazine's Hall of Fame, Holdsworth is a five-time winner in their readers' poll..
